Bayern Munich completed an almost perfect UEFA Champions League group stage campaign (W5, D1) with a 1-0 win away to Manchester United during the week, an appropriate prelude to their return to Bundesliga action when they will continue to pursue league leaders Bayer Leverkusen. Their ambitions took a huge hit in the previous round as Bayern were surprisingly defeated 5-1 by Frankfurt in what was their equal-heaviest league loss since 2000.

Hopes are high of a continued Bayern resurgence as they have picked up 16 home points, their best return at this stage since racking up as many in the 2017/18 campaign. Furthermore, their 27 scored goals across just six home league games this campaign has set a new club record in the Bundesliga, with each of those six matches producing a 3+ goal haul for the Bavarians.

Trying to stop them this weekend will be unlikely title chasers Stuttgart, who sit just one point behind their hosts, albeit having played one game more.Their preparations for this mammoth clash have been rocked by reports during the week which suggested that top scorer Serhou Guirassy (G16) has rejected a new contract offer and is “ready to take the next step” – possibly as soon as January!

Perhaps focusing on the positives is the way to go for now, and Stuttgart have many to think of as their current 31-point haul is their second-best in the Bundesliga behind only their 34 points accrued at this stage in 2003/04 en route to a fourth-placed finish. The visitors won’t let their underdog status put them off building on that strong start, underlined by a respectable W1, D1, L1 record from their three league games as pre-match outsiders.

Players to watch: Bayern talisman Harry Kane (BUN: G18, A5) assisted their winner on his return to England during the week, and four of his last five scoring appearances for the club saw him net at least twice. Trying to outdo him will be Stuttgart’s own Premier League arrival, Brighton loanee Deniz Undav, who has netted the winner with three of his last five goals for the club.

Hot stat: Bayern Munich have won more Bundesliga games against Stuttgart (W68, D22, L18) than any other side.
